25 Best Pluralsight Courses Online [Bestseller Courses 2025]

Best Pluralsight Courses

Pluralsight provides courses on technology-related topics like IT, Data Science, Information & Cyber Security, etc. So, if you are looking for the Best Pluralsight Courses, this article is for you. In this article, you will find the 25 Best Pluralsight Courses.

Now without further ado, let’s get started-

Best Pluralsight Courses

For your convenience, I have divided the courses into various sections such as Data Science, Web Development, and Java.

So, let’s start with the best Pluralsight courses for data science

Best Pluralsight Courses for Data Science

1. Data Science: Executive Briefing

Level- Beginner

Time to Complete- 27 minutes

In this course, you will gain the ability to transform data into actionable insight. First, you will learn what data science is. Next, you will discover why data science is essential for you and your business.

Finally, you will explore how to get started becoming a data-driven organization. After completing this course, you will have the skills and knowledge of data science needed to transform data into actionable insight.

Interested to Enroll?

If yes, check the course details here- Data Science: Executive Briefing

2. Data Science with R

Level- Beginner

Time to Complete- 2 hours 30 min

In this course, first, you will learn about the practice of data science, the R programming language, and how they can be used to transform data into actionable insight.

After that, you will learn how to transform and clean your data and create and interpret descriptive statistics, data visualizations, and statistical models.

And at the end of this course, you will learn how to handle Big Data, make predictions using machine learning algorithms, and deploy R to production.

Interested to Enroll?

If yes, check the course details here- Data Science with R

3. Analyzing Business Requirements for Data Science

Level- Beginner

Time to Complete- 50 min

This course will teach you the strategic, practical, and technical skills to discover if data science can indeed benefit your organization.

First, you will see how to gather and manage the right stakeholders to provide a solid Data Science story to your company that adds REAL business value.

Next, you will discover how to determine and risk assess your data science business and technical requirements. At the end of this course, you will explore how to quantify the business problems and learn what to do when mitigating the risk of a project not yielding business value.

Interested to Enroll?

If yes, check the course details here-Analyzing Business Requirements for Data Science

4. Doing Data Science with Python

Level- Beginner

Time to Complete- 6 hours 24 min

In this course, you will learn everything from extracting data from different sources to exposing your machine learning model as API endpoints that can be consumed in a real-world data solution.

This course will help you to implement the concepts in an industry-standard approach by utilizing Python and related libraries.

Interested to Enroll?

If yes, check the course details here- Doing Data Science with Python

5. Beginning Data Visualization with R

Level- Beginner

Time to Complete– 3 hours

In this course, you will learn how to answer questions about your data by creating data visualizations with R. This course will cover how to visualize One Categorical Variable, One Numeric Variable, Two Categorical Variables, Two Numeric Variables, and Both a Categorical and a Numeric Variable.

Interested to Enroll?

If yes, check the course details here-Beginning Data Visualization with R

6. Advanced Pandas

Level- Intermediate

Time to Complete- 2 hours 30 minutes

In this course, you will learn the skills you need to perform data analysis that is effective and full of useful insights. First, you will learn how to prepare your dataset for a smoother experience.

After that, you will discover how to perform database-style joins, work with higher-dimensional data, analyze time series, and apply window operations. 

At the end of this course, you will explore how to present the data by generating informative and appealing plots.

Interested to Enroll?

If yes, check the course details here- Advanced Pandas

7. Boost Data Science Productivity with PyCharm

Level- Intermediate

Time to Complete- 2 hours 33 minutes

In this course, you will gain the ability to use PyCharm’s most relevant features for Data Science projects.  First, you will learn to understand code faster, by finding usages, creating class diagrams, viewing hierarchies, and accessing documentation.

Then, you will discover how to write better code faster by using PyCharm features, such as code completion, refactoring, and inspections, as well as how to debug code by using breakpoints, stepping, and remote debugging. 

At the end of this course,  you will learn how to explore data by using the scientific mode in PyCharm, Jupyter notebooks, running R script, and SQL queries. 

Interested to Enroll?

If yes, check the course details here- Boost Data Science Productivity with PyCharm

8. Introduction to Data Visualization with Python

Level- Intermediate

Time to Complete- 1 hour 28 min

In this course, you will learn how to use several essential data visualization techniques to answer real-world questions. First, you’ll explore techniques including scatter plots. Then, you’ll discover line charts and time series. In the end, you’ll learn what to do when your data is too big. 

After completing this course, you will have a foundational knowledge of data visualization.

Interested to Enroll?

If yes, check the course details here- Introduction to Data Visualization with Python

9. Designing Machine Learning Solutions on Microsoft Azure

Level- Intermediate

Time to Complete-

In this course, you will how to leverage Azure’s Machine Learning capabilities to greatly increase the chance of success for your data science project. 

First, you will engage in team workflow and how Microsoft’s Team Data Science Process (TDSP) enables best practices across disciplines. Then, you will discover the workflow of the Azure Machine Learning Service and how it can be leveraged on your project.

You will also review how to create a pipeline for your data preparation, model training, and model registration. At the end of this course, you will explore the infrastructure approaches that can be leveraged for machine learning and how those approaches are supported on Azure. 

Interested to Enroll?

If yes, check the course details here- Designing Machine Learning Solutions on Microsoft Azure

10. Create and Monitor Data Pipelines for a Batch Processing Solution

Level- Advanced

Time to Complete- 1 hour 29 min

In this course, you will learn to design and implement data pipelines for a batch processing solution.  First, you’ll explore the available data storage on Azure. Then, you’ll discover and develop batch processing solutions using Azure Data Factory and the available data storage.

At the end of this course, you’ll learn how to automate the data processing process and how to monitor for optimization and efficiency.

Interested to Enroll?

If yes, check the course details here- Create and Monitor Data Pipelines for a Batch Processing Solution

So, these are the 10 Best Pluralsight Courses for Data Science.

Now, let’s see the best Pluralsight courses for web development

Best Pluralsight Courses for Web Development

1. Front End Web Development: Get Started

Level- Beginner

Time to Complete- 3 hours 47 min

In this course, you will learn all the basics of all of the different aspects of front-end web development, and how to hone and keep your skills up to date.

In this course, you will learn all about front end web dev, including:

  • Helpful web dev tools
  • HTML structure
  • CSS rules and concepts
  • Basic JavaScript concepts
  • Basics of HTTP
  • Browser capabilities and tools
  • Basic libraries & tools (jQuery, etc.)
  • Much more

Interested to Enroll?

If yes, check the course details here- Front End Web Development: Get Started

2. Introduction to Web Development

Level- Beginner

Time to Complete- 10 hours 57 min

This course covers all of the tools you’ll need to create websites. In this course, you will learn in-depth discussions about each of “The Big Three” tools used for Website development– HTML, CSS, and JavaScript.

Interested to Enroll?

If yes, check the course details here-Introduction to Web Development

3. Front End Web Development Career Kickstart

Level- Beginner

Time to Complete- 1 hour 47 min

This course covers everything from the history of the web development industry to the landscape of the web and details of a front-end web developer’s daily workflow, then finishes strong with information on how to interview for a position and grow a career after getting in the door.

Interested to Enroll?

If yes, check the course details here- Front End Web Development Career Kickstart

4. Flask: Getting Started

Level- Beginner

Time to Complete- 2 hours 4 min

In this course, you will learn the basics of Flask to get started with Python web development. First, you will learn how to create a Flask view function. Then, you will discover how to create HTML pages. 

At the end of this course, you will explore web forms and handling user input. This course will help you to write code for a Flask web application.

Interested to Enroll?

If yes, check the course details here- Flask: Getting Started

5. Building Your First API with ASP.NET Core 2

Level- Beginner

Time to Complete- 4 hours 7 min

In this course, you will learn how to build an API with ASP.NET Core that connects to a database via Entity Framework Core. This course will cover major topics like getting resources from services and manipulating them, the built-in dependency injection system & logger, working with different environments, configuration files and middleware, and Entity Framework Core related features like working with migrations and seeding the database.

Interested to Enroll?

If yes, check the course details here-Building Your First API with ASP.NET Core 2

6. HTML Fundamentals

Level- Beginner

Time to Complete- 2 hours 19 min

This course will cover the basics of HTML markup. Then, you will explore lists, tables, and text. In the end, you will discover how to add images to your web pages.

At the end of this course, you will have a foundational knowledge of HTML that will help you as you move forward in web development.

Interested to Enroll?

If yes, check the course details here- HTML Fundamentals

7. Progressive Web Apps: Sensor Integrations

Level- Intermediate

Time to Complete- 1 hour 55 min

In this course, you will explore Geo sensors to identify user location, identify local landmarks, and even offer navigation through Google Maps. Then, you will learn how to capture photos, audio, and video and play them on your handset to create a video diary. 

At the end of this course, you will discover how to sense network availability and speed to architect and deliver compelling offline experiences, syncing back online when the network returns. 

Interested to Enroll?

If yes, check the course details here- Progressive Web Apps: Sensor Integrations

8. Django Fundamentals

Level- Intermediate

Time to Complete- 3 hours 42 min

In this course, you will learn how to build a complete web application with Django. First, you will see how to create attractively styled pages using Django templates. Then, you will learn how to add URL mappings for these pages and handle user interaction with forms.

At the end of this course, you will learn how to store and manipulate data. This course will provide a good overview of all the essential parts of Django and how they work together.

Interested to Enroll?

If yes, check the course details here- Django Fundamentals

9. Web Development with Django and AngularJS

Level- Intermediate

Time to Complete- 3 hours 41 min

In this course, you will learn how to get the best of both worlds with web development in Django and AngularJS. First, you will discover how to create a basic web application with Django.

Then, you will explore using AngularJS to add an interactive front-end. In the end, you will learn how to use REST and AJAX to pass data between the front-end JavaScript and back-end Python code.

Interested to Enroll?

If yes, check the course details here-Web Development with Django and AngularJS

10. Advanced Web Application Penetration Testing with Burp Suite

Level- Advanced

Time to Complete- 1 hour 48 min

This course will expand your knowledge of the Burp Suite product to utilize many of the lesser-known features offered in the tool. In this course, you will learn how to exploit security vulnerabilities in your target, how to write your Burp extension, how to perform automation with Burp, and more.

After completing this course, you will know how to perform all of these techniques at a comfortable and efficient level to better perform your tasks.

Interested to Enroll?

If yes, check the course details here- Advanced Web Application Penetration Testing with Burp

So, these are the 10 Best Pluralsight Courses for Web Development.

Now, let’s see the best Java courses on Pluralsight

Best Java Courses on Pluralsight

1. Getting Started with Programming in Java

Level- Beginner

Time to Complete- 4 hours 42 min

In this course, you will learn everything you need to know to get started developing applications using the Java programming language. First, you will learn how to create an application, structure statements, declare variables, use primitive types, and provide application control flow.

Then, you will explore how to work with more sophisticated language elements such as arrays, methods, and parameters. In the end, you will discover how to accept command-line arguments, interact with the user, and work with rich data types such as strings and dates. 

Interested to Enroll?

If yes, check the course details here- Getting Started with Programming in Java

2. Introduction to Testing in Java

Level- Beginner

Time to Complete- 3 hours 53 min

This course covers why you want to write automated tests for your code and how to implement this in Java, covering the fundamentals of how to write simple tests using JUnit and Hamcrest, through Test-Driven Development (TDD).

Interested to Enroll?

If yes, check the course details here- Introduction to Testing in Java

3. Java EE 7 Fundamentals

Level- Beginner

Time to Complete- 5 hours

In this course, you will learn how the Java EE platform has progressed through its history to the modern platform it is today, the foundations of building a web application in Java EE, and how to interoperate Java EE applications with external services.

Then you will learn about architectural best practices when building a Java EE application. 

Interested to Enroll?

If yes, check the course details here-Java EE 7 Fundamentals

4. Java Persistence API 2.2

Level- Intermediate

Time to Complete- 4 hours

In this course, you will learn the principle of object-relational mapping (ORM) and use Java Persistence API (JPA) to map your Java objects into relational databases.

Interested to Enroll?

If yes, check the course details here- Java Persistence API 2.2

5. Advanced Java Concurrent Patterns

Level- Advanced

Time to Complete- 3 hours 27 min

In this course, you will how you can improve the quality of your concurrent code, by using sophisticated concurrent tools that allow for smooth lock acquisition and fault tolerance. 

You will also learn advanced data structures, such as the copy on write arrays, the concurrent blocking queues, the concurrent skip lists, and concurrent hashmaps.

Interested to Enroll?

If yes, check the course details here-Advanced Java Concurrent Patterns

And here the list ends. I hope these 25 Best Pluralsight Courses will help you. I would suggest you bookmark this article for future referrals. Now it’s time to wrap up.

Conclusion

In this article, I tried to cover the 25 Best Pluralsight Courses. If you have any doubts or questions, feel free to ask me in the comment section.

Thank YOU!

Explore More about Data Science, Visit Here

Subscribe For More Updates!

[mc4wp_form id=”28437″]

Though of the Day…

It’s what you learn after you know it all that counts.’

John Wooden

author image

Written By Aqsa Zafar

Founder of MLTUT, Machine Learning Ph.D. scholar at Dayananda Sagar University. Research on social media depression detection. Create tutorials on ML and data science for diverse applications. Passionate about sharing knowledge through website and social media.

Leave a Comment

Your email address will not be published. Required fields are marked *